I don't think they are starving.
They just have the mechanism to grab anything that first touches the skirts or falls on their disc. Some times they are already fed, and after ingesting, they still try to grab more food when the open again. That's the mechanism and it's a natural reaction.
Yes, most Palythoas and Protopalythoas close up fast when food is offered.
If they won't eat it they reject after grabbing it.
